Thermoplastic Convex Road Marking Machinesoffer an innovative solution for road safety. These machines create highly visible Road Markings that enhance driver awareness. The technology utilizes thermoplastic materials that are durable and resistant to various weather conditions. When properly applied, these markings remain bright and clear for years, reducing the need for frequent replacements.
When selecting a Thermoplastic Convex Road Marking Machine, consider the machine's productivity and ease of use. Look for models that offer adjustable temperature control. This feature ensures optimal melting and application of materials. It is also crucial to pay attention to the machine’s weight and design for mobility. A heavy machine can be cumbersome, while a lightweight model may be easier to maneuver around tight corners.
Tips: Always conduct a trial run before full application. This helps you understand the machine's settings. Additionally, invest in training for your operators to maximize efficiency. Regular maintenance of the machine is vital too. Neglecting care can lead to decreased performance and higher repair costs. Consider scheduling check-ups after frequent use. Thermoplastic convex road marking machines are designed for efficiency. They are ideal for creating durable road markings. These machines ensure visibility and safety on roads. Their design features a heated application process that melts thermoplastic material. This results in strong, long-lasting markings. The ease of use makes them popular among road maintenance teams.
Key features include adjustable temperature settings. Operators can control the heat for different materials. This versatility improves performance on various surfaces. Additionally, many models have ergonomic designs. They facilitate ease of handling and reduce operator fatigue. Some machines come with built-in paint mixers. This ensures consistent color and texture for the markings.
However, there can be challenges. Users may encounter difficulties with calibration. Ensuring proper temperature is critical for quality output. It's important to maintain the machines regularly. Neglect can lead to inconsistent lines and wasted materials.

When looking into the wholesale prices of road marking machines, several factors come into play. Demand fluctuates seasonally. During peak construction times, prices may rise. Many manufacturers scale production, which affects availability. If there's excess inventory, prices may drop. It’s a balancing act.
Material costs impact the final price too. High-quality thermoplastics can be expensive. This directly influences the cost of a Convex Road Marking Machine. The geographic location of suppliers also matters. Shipping fees can vary widely. Sometimes, local products are more affordable than imports.
Consider the competition among manufacturers. When more companies enter the market, prices may decline. However, not all machines are created equal. Some may lack essential features. This can lead to unexpected repair costs later. Always assess long-term value versus upfront price.

Maintaining road marking machines is vital for ensuring efficiency. These machines require regular checks and servicing. According to a recent industry report, 30% of road marking issues stem from neglect in maintenance. Simple tasks, like cleaning the spray tips and checking the paint consistency, can extend the machine's lifespan.
Operation procedures also need attention. Operators must be well-versed in machine settings. Incorrect settings can lead to uneven markings. In fact, a survey showed that 25% of poorly done markings are due to operator error. Training sessions can help reduce this problem. Even minor adjustments can make a big difference.
Lastly, it’s essential to track machine performance over time. Monitoring output and maintenance history helps identify patterns. Machines that receive regular maintenance often report 15% better performance. Recognizing signs of wear and tear prevents costly repairs. Regularly reviewing operation logs encourages a culture of accountability and improvement.

The 200HS Cold Plastic Spray Machine (MMA 1:1) is an impressive advancement in surface application technology. This machine is specifically designed for efficiency and precision, making it an essential tool for professionals in the field. Its advanced shock mitigation system minimizes vibrations, greatly enhancing user comfort and maintaining high-quality application standards. The lightweight fixed device of the nozzle allows for increased maneuverability, ensuring that operators can achieve even coverage on various surfaces, an essential factor for successful applications.
One of the standout features of the 200HS is its imported nozzle, crafted to deliver consistent spray patterns and durability over time. This is complemented by a continuous cooling system that prevents material from overheating during operation, thus preserving the quality of the application. Furthermore, its innovative static mixing device ensures that Component A and Component B are combined thoroughly at a 1:1 ratio, essential for achieving optimal chemical bonding and overall performance. A significant benefit of this machine is its automatic quick-cleaning feature, which reduces downtime and enhances productivity, making it an attractive option for contractors focused on efficiency.
